By Kehinde Okeowo
A netizen identified on X as @iamkowho, who claimed to be the former manager of Nigerian influencer Emmanuel Obruste—better known as GehGeh—has confirmed that his wedding video currently trending online is authentic.
Speaking in a clip reposted by the popular content creator on TikTok, the X user also made explosive claims that the influencer’s actions ruined his marriage.
According to the skit maker’s ex-manager, he sacrificed his three-year marriage while supporting the influencer, only to be betrayed when GehGeh secretly tied the knot.
“I was GehGeh’s manager. I listened to him, fought with my wife, who I’ve been married to for three years, and left my marriage, only for him to betray me by getting married,” he alleged.
The internet user, who claimed to have known GehGeh since 2008, further added that he left his home and wife after being convinced by the influencer.
“Last 3 years, I got married to a beautiful lady. Everything was good. This boy convinced me. I left that Gege. The house we were living together, I left the house for her. This boy from my back stabbed me,” he lamented.
He went on to announce that he was severing ties with GehGeh, declaring: “Today, I ceased to become Gege’s manager. I am not a manager to that boy again. That boy is a deceiver. He doesn’t finish my life. He done finish my life.”
Despite expressing sadness over the internet personality’s betrayal, he went on to wish him a happy married life.
GehGeh, who is well known for advising men against marriage and traditional relationship structures, reportedly got married to his partner, Mary, in a private traditional wedding ceremony in Niger State recently.
The videos from the private event, which later circulated widely online on 25 July 2026, sparked mixed reactions after making the rounds.
